    This works fine for me on 10.5.5.
    To narrow things down, create a new user and log in as that user. See if the problem happens for that user too. If it doesn't then it is something specific to your account, not the OS. If it doesn't happen for the other user, log in as the user that is misbehaving and navigate to ~/Library/Preferences/ and drag com.apple.finder.plist to the trash. Then Control-Option-Click on the Finder icon in the Dock and select Relaunch. When the Finder comes back up, does the problem still occur?

    There is a thing in OSX that is called "key focus" or "focus".
    When you type on your keyboard (text or any keyboard shortcut), the OS has to know where to send that command to if you have multiple windows open (or multiple applications).  The answer is, it directs the command to the window that has "key focus".
    The key focus window is the one with the active window title bar (not grayed out) and the colored three buttons in the upper left corner (unfortunately, Logic doesn't use colors).
    Now to Logic:
    Logic follows the same rules. However, you have to pay attention to multi-pane windows like the Arrange window. This is a window with more windows (panes) inside. Now the question is, which window pane inside that window has key focus. If you look closely, then you see that the window frame changes  their shade slightly (sometimes very hard to see). Pay especially attention to plugins. They also have key focus when selected and can receive keystrokes.
    Finally to your question.
    You cannot set the preferences on which monitor screen Logic opens  a window. This is determined by the location of the window that has currently key focus. Any new window and also alert windows and dialog windows  (Save, Open) will open on that screen.
    So if you want a window to open on you external screen, click on a Logic window on that screen.
    I have five monitors on my Logic setup and I use a QuicKeys macro (push one button) that sets the key focus to my main monitor and now any new window will open on that screen screen.

    I don't know if this is the problem, but for windows in "Icon" or "List" view that are set so that the "Toolbar" is not showing, a folder opened within that window will tend to open a new window. This is just a difference in behaviour between the two modes. To show / hide the toolbar, try clicking the elongated button in the upper right corner, in the "titlebar" of the window, or choose "Show Toolbar" / "Hide Toolbar" from the "View" menu.
    Additionally, a workaround might be to switch to "Column" view ("View" > "as Columns" ⌘3), since opening a folder within a window in "Column" view does not appear to spawn a new window, even with the "Toolbar" hidden. Another option might be to hold down the "option" key while opening the folder - this causes the previous window to close as the new window is opened.

    Let me see if I understand the original problem. You can checked the preference on the following tab to divert new windows to tabs instead:
    Firefox menu > Preferences > Tabs
    And that was not working correctly, either on all sites or a few particular sites.
    Note that by default, sites that open a new window with particular specifications, such as the size, bypass that setting. To force even those windows into a new tab, you can use the about:config preference editor.
    In a new tab, type or paste '''about:config''' and press Enter. Click the button promising to be careful.
    In the filter box, type or paste '''link.o''' and pause while the list is filtered.
    Double click these and set the value as desired:
    '''(A) browser.link.open_newwindow'''
    '''3 = divert new window to a new tab''' (<u>default</u>) (checked*)<br>
    2 = allow link to open a new window (unchecked*)<br>
    1 = force new window into same tab
    '''*''' First checkbox in Options > Tabs
    '''(B) browser.link.open_newwindow.restriction''' - for links in Firefox tabs
    '''0 = apply the setting under (A) to ALL new windows (even script windows)<br>
    2 = apply the setting under (A) to normal windows, but NOT to script windows with features (<u>default</u>)<br>
    1 = override the setting under (A) and always use new windows
    '''(C) browser.link.open_newwindow.override.external''' - for links in other programs
    -1 = apply the setting under (A) to external links (<u>default</u>)<br>
    '''3 = open external links in a new tab in the last active window'''<br>
    2 = open external links in a new window<br>
    1 = open external links in the last active tab replacing the current page
